Rachel (mimbza) | 647 comments Mullumbimby by Melissa Lucashenko Mullumbimby is an award-winning contemporary fiction by Indigenous Australian author Melissa Lucashenko. It features smart and sassy Jo Breen who finally achieves her dream of owning a property in her ancestral Bundjalung country only to run into problems with the neighbours, her horses, her teenage daughter, and last but not least, the handsome new bloke in town who is putting together a controversial Land Rights claim. ⭐⭐⭐⭐ here is my review

Rachel (mimbza) | 647 comments The Seven Skins of Esther Wilding by Holly Ringland The Seven Skins of Esther Wilding by Australian author Holly Ringland is a magical book set in Tasmania, Copenhagen and the Faroe Islands. It covers Indigenous stories, Nordic mythology, selkies and fairytales as Esther tries to piece together what happened to her sister Aurora and what the seven verses tattooed on her back meant. ⭐⭐⭐⭐ here is my review
